+In printed output formats, the reference mark for a footnote is a
+small, superscripted number; the text of the footnote appears at the
+bottom of the page, below a horizontal line.
+
+In Info, the reference mark for a footnote is a pair of parentheses
+with the footnote number between them, like this: @samp{(1)}.  The
+reference mark is followed by a cross-reference link to the footnote
+text if footnotes are put in separate nodes (@pxref{Footnote Styles}).
+
+In the HTML output, footnote references are generally marked with a
+small, superscripted number which is rendered as a hypertext link to
+the footnote text.
